How To Choose The Best Antioxidant Drink

Antioxidant drinks vary wildly in potency, from diluted juice blends to concentrated superfruit extracts. Focus on three key factors to separate genuine health aids from overpriced flavored water.

Check the Form: Concentrate vs. Ready-to-Drink vs. Powder

Concentrates offer the highest dose per serving and are cost-effective for daily use—a tablespoon of elderberry or tart cherry concentrate packs more anthocyanins than an entire bottle of diluted juice. Ready-to-drink cold-pressed juices deliver convenience without loss of heat-sensitive polyphenols but often come at a premium. Powders, like greens blends, combine multiple antioxidant sources but require careful sourcing to avoid low-quality fillers.

Verify the Sugar and Ingredient Purity

Look for “no added sugar” and “not from concentrate” on the label. Added sugars spike insulin and undermine the anti-inflammatory benefits of the antioxidants themselves. The purest options list a single fruit ingredient—like “organic pomegranate” or “wild blueberry juice”—with no preservatives, natural flavors, or sweeteners.

Target Specific Antioxidant Compounds

Different fruits deliver different compounds. Elderberry leads in quercetin and has one of the highest ORAC scores of any fruit. Tart cherry provides melatonin and anthocyanins for sleep and muscle recovery. Pomegranate is rich in punicalagin for heart health. Match the drink to your specific wellness goal rather than assuming all antioxidants are interchangeable.

FAQ

Which fruit has the highest antioxidant content among these drinks?
Elderberry has the highest ORAC score of any fruit—roughly three times that of blueberry—and contains more quercetin per gram than any other common fruit. For maximum antioxidant density per serving, elderberry concentrate is the clear winner.
Can I use tart cherry concentrate for sleep if I don’t have sleep issues?
Yes. The melatonin in Montmorency tart cherry is naturally present in small amounts, so it promotes relaxation without acting as a sedative. Many users drink it purely for the anthocyanin content to support muscle recovery and reduce post-exercise inflammation.
How do I store concentrated antioxidant drinks once opened?
Most concentrates, like elderberry and tart cherry, should be refrigerated after opening and used within a few weeks to maintain freshness. Ready-to-drink juices in glass bottles should also be refrigerated and consumed within seven days to prevent spoilage and nutrient degradation.
